A tranquil London base in an exclusive, well located residential area for guests who appreciate a personal welcome in a beautiful private house. Choose a Luxurious sun-filled double room on the first floor with king size bed, leading to a superb marble lined private bathroom with views over the garden. Classic English styling - rather like the Savoy in its former classic glory, but even better! Or, our simpler but spacious double room on the second floor, with use of bathroom, also south facing with a lovely view. We love to give guests all the inside information on London and the local area, usually over a delicious breakfast. Personalised Breakfast and even dinner can be provided on request, simply tell your host your heart's desire. We are also delighted that we are able to offer you a 'Therapy Room' where you can experience our range of relaxing Deep Tissue or Traditional Thai Treatment massage, and even one-to-one Yoga instruction. All with caring professionals. The perfect way to relax and unwind, de-stress... Deal with jet lag and fall into a deep and beautiful slumber.

We had a wonderful stay at H.P.H. in 2017 and knew we'd return for a stay in 2019! Although Swan was not in London at the time of our stay, her team of Mariam, Nelum & Napoleon did a marvelous job taking care of us. H.P.H. has a quiet, comfortable, laid-back feel that appealed to us. We had the Deluxe room with a large bathroom. The breakfasts by Napoleon were so good and plentiful. A generous take away breakfast was packed for on last day as we had a early train to catch. We also enjoyed a takeaway dinner in the relaxing garden, a nice option to dining at the restaurant. Our stay, like before, was memorable and we were so fortunate to have discovered such an extraordinary B&B in Holland Park.
